Historical Marker

Athens

PA 199 (old US 220) at Tioga Point Cemetery, Athens · Athens · Bradford

Pennsylvania marker

Inscription

Known also as Tioga Point. Connecticut settlers laid out the village in 1786. Site of ancient Indian village of Teaoga. Base for the Sullivan Campaign into central N.Y. Gateway from Southern N.Y. into Pennsylvania for centuries.
